Twisted pair cables and optical cables are two common network transmission media, each with its own advantages and disadvantages. Here is their comparison:

 

Bandwidth and transmission distance: The bandwidth of optical cables is much larger than that of twisted pair cables, which can support higher data transmission rates and longer transmission distances. Fiber optic cables are suitable for long-distance transmission and high-speed data transmission, such as remote video surveillance, network video transmission, etc. The bandwidth and transmission distance of twisted pair cables are relatively low, usually not exceeding 100 meters.

 

Anti interference: Fiber optic cables use optical signals for transmission, and the probability of interference is very small, so fiber optic cables have better anti-interference properties compared to twisted pair cables. Although twisted pair cables can reduce electromagnetic interference by twisting, their performance will be affected in strong interference environments

 

Cost: The installation and maintenance cost of twisted pair cables is relatively low, while unshielded twisted pair (UTP) is widely used for Ethernet installation due to its low price. In contrast, the cost of fiber optic cables is relatively high, and installation and maintenance are also relatively difficult, requiring special tools and techniques

 

Flexibility and ease of use: Twisted pair cables are easy to install and use, especially for short distance data and voice transmission. Although optical cables have better transmission performance than twisted pair cables, they require higher installation and maintenance requirements and are not as flexible and easy to use as twisted pair cables.
